Social Media Marketing Tips for BA (Hons) Marketing

Social media has become an essential tool for marketing professionals, especially for those pursuing a Bachelor of Arts in Marketing. With the rise of platforms like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, and LinkedIn, it is crucial for students to understand how to effectively utilize social media for marketing purposes. Here are some tips to help BA (Hons) Marketing students excel in social media marketing:

1. Know Your Audience

Before diving into social media marketing, it is important to understand your target audience. Conduct research to identify the demographics, interests, and behaviors of your potential customers. This will help you create content that resonates with your audience and drives engagement.

2. Create a Content Calendar

Consistency is key in social media marketing. Develop a content calendar to plan out your posts in advance. This will help you stay organized and ensure that you are posting regularly to keep your audience engaged.

3. Utilize Visuals

Visual content tends to perform better on social media than text-only posts. Incorporate eye-catching images, videos, and infographics into your social media strategy to grab the attention of your audience and increase engagement.

4. Engage with Your Audience

Social media is a two-way street. Make sure to respond to comments, messages, and mentions from your followers. Engaging with your audience shows that you care about their feedback and can help build a loyal community around your brand.

5. Analyze Your Performance

Monitor the performance of your social media campaigns using analytics tools. Track key metrics such as reach, engagement, and conversions to understand what is working and what can be improved. Use this data to optimize your strategy and achieve better results.

6. Stay Updated on Trends

Social media is constantly evolving, with new features and trends emerging regularly. Stay informed about the latest developments in the social media landscape and adapt your strategy accordingly to stay ahead of the competition.

7. Collaborate with Influencers

Influencer marketing can be a powerful tool for reaching a larger audience and building credibility for your brand. Identify influencers in your niche and collaborate with them to promote your products or services to their followers.

8. Use Paid Advertising

While organic reach is important, paid advertising can help amplify your social media efforts and reach a wider audience. Consider investing in social media ads to boost your visibility and drive conversions.

9. Network with Peers

Networking is essential in the field of marketing. Connect with your peers, industry professionals, and potential collaborators on social media platforms to expand your network and stay informed about industry trends.

10. Stay Authentic

Above all, authenticity is key in social media marketing. Be genuine in your interactions with your audience and stay true to your brand values. Building trust with your followers will lead to long-term success in your social media efforts.

Key Metric Description
Reach The number of unique users who see your content
Engagement The level of interaction (likes, comments, shares) your content receives
Conversions The number of users who take a desired action (purchase, sign-up) after engaging with your content
